Two UK ticket-holders each win £41.8m share of EuroMillions jackpot
The draw includes a £500,000 Thunderball top prize and automatic entry into the UK Millionaire Maker, officials said.
- Two UK Players and a winner in France shared The National Lottery EuroMillions jackpot of £126 million on Tuesday, with each UK winner claiming more than £41 million.
- All Players entering The National Lottery EuroMillions automatically gain entry into the Millionaire Maker, which creates new millionaires weekly through a separate draw code selection.
- The National Lottery EuroMillions winning numbers were 13, 16, 29, 40, and 47, with Lucky Stars 04 and 3. The Thunderball numbers were 3, 7, 24, 31, and 35, with The Thunderball 2.
- Andy Carter, senior winners advisor at Allwyn, urged Players to check their tickets, saying: "It's been another great night for EuroMillions players as two lucky UK winners have won an incredible share of tonight's £126million jackpot prize."
- When Players win the National Lottery, a 180-day countdown begins to claim the prize; After that period, all unclaimed money goes to the National Lottery Good Causes.
